采用多层感知器(MLP)与误差反向传播算法(error back-propagationalgorithm)构造与监督训练人工神经网络,采用了改进的非线性激励函数与学习率的误差反向传播算法。超声无损检测的计算机模拟与实验结果表明,改进的BP算法收敛速度较之常规BP算法明显加快。%The model of multilayer perceptron (MLP) and back-propagation(BP) training algorithm in artificial neural network are employed.New ideas are proposed to improve BP algorithm in aspects of nonlinear activation function and learning rate.Simulation and experiment results are also presented to demonstrate the effect of improvement in ultrasonic nondestructive testing.
